Accused appears in court for possession of unwrought gold. image source: Pixabay

Sam Nxumalo (58) appeared in the Klerksdorp Magistrates’ Court on Friday, 10 November 2023, facing charges of possession of unwrought gold.

Members of the Hawks’ Serious Organised Crime Investigation in collaboration with Klerksdorp District Illicit Mining Task Team received information on Thursday, 09 November 2023, about a suspect who was allegedly spotted in possession of suspected gold in Klerksdorp CBD.

The information was operationalised, and the team pounced on the suspect. He was searched, and a gold button as well as red soil suspected to be gold bearing material were found in his possession. The team further conducted a search at the suspect’s house which led to a discovery of a red, black and grey soil suspected to be gold bearing material.

The suspect was subsequently arrested and charged with possession of unwrought gold. He appeared in court this morning and his matter was postponed to 15 November 2023 for formal bail application.

The North West Head of the Directorate for Priority Crime Investigation, Major General Patrick Mbotho, has welcomed the arrest and expressed gratitude to the positive information received from an informant.
